i have a male hogg about 4'-4'1/2 long and about 2 years old if not older he was under fed alot and i got him takin down some f/t jumbo mice these things are huge. but i was wondering how big arround these guys get. could some1 please post a pic of a adult male and female or let me know about how long/big girth is on these ad adults. thank you alot.

Replies (7)

Jonathan_Brady May 31, 2003 03:51 PM

if your 2 year old male hog is 4-4.5', i'd say it was fed a lot. he's an island boa that is naturally smaller than his mainland counterpart and at 2 years of age, probably should not be equal to or great than what a 2 year old mainland bci should measure. matter of fact, some hogs never reach that length. you could probably feed that animal about 18 meals a year or less and that would be sufficient for natural growth/girth/development for the rest of his life.

thanks for your input and i know that they are a smaller species but i am feeding it 1 jumbo mouse every 8 days and that isnt leaving much of a dent when i feed him to my friend feeding it 4 small mice every 14 days so yeah i would say it was under fed. thanks for replying tho

Jonathan_Brady May 31, 2003 04:17 PM

move up to appopriately sized rats and feed every 3-4 weeks. that would be a natural feeding regimen. trust me, if your hog is 4.5 feet right now at 2 years of age, it's been overfed.
